Arthur Montagu Brookfield, 'East Sussex'
Leslie Ward · Vanity Fair, 29 September 1898

Leslie Ward ('Spy') renders Colonel Arthur Montagu Brookfield, Conservative MP for East Sussex, in the idiom of Vanity Fair's Statesmen series (plate 700). The full-length chromolithograph shows a trim, mustachioed gentleman mid-stride in a dark frock coat and grey trousers, brown gloves clutched around a top hat in one hand and a bamboo cane trailing from the other — the complete equipment of a late-Victorian gentleman of consequence. The caption reads simply *'East Sussex.'* No ethnic caricature is present; Ward's mild distortions — the slight elongation of the torso, the brisk self-satisfied stride — are class caricature rather than personal malice, gently mocking a soldier-politician who embodied respectable Tory Sussex rather than any dramatic political cause.
